Weather & Geography Kharkada
Weather & Geography Kharkada, Darchula, Nepal read the weather & geography of Kharkada, how to plan a trip to Kharkada, things to do in Kharkada and much more
Show map
Currency Exchange Rate
to
1 =
1 =